About Bibbs Lake

Bibbs Lake invites outdoor lovers to experience a peaceful retreat in Coweta County, Georgia. Its modest size of 88 acres provides an intimate setting for nature enthusiasts seeking quiet waters and scenic views. The lake's shallow depth enhances accessibility and creates a welcoming environment for a variety of outdoor activities throughout the year. Surrounded by the communities of Newnan, Whitesburg, and East Newnan, Bibbs Lake sits within reach of local towns while maintaining a tranquil atmosphere. The nearby Chattahoochee Bend State Park adds a touch of natural charm to the area, framing the lake within a broader landscape of Georgia's outdoor offerings.
